Code Sample Name: SendMail
Feature Area: Messaging
Description:
This sample demonstrates the use of several CEMAPI APIs. Using these APIs,
the sample application sends an e-mail message per account to a list of
recipients. One message per each account on the device (POP3, ActiveSync,
etc) will be stored in that account抯 outbox. The recipient list, subject,
and message body are specified in code and can be changed. When the program
is complete, the message(s) will either be in the device抯 outbox, or will
have been sent if the appropriate partnership is set up.
Basic program flow:
Logon to the message store
Get the message stores table
For each entry (i.e. local account)
Open current store entry
Get the Drafts folder (necessary for outgoing mail)
Create a new message in this folder
Set relevant message properties (Recipients, Subject, Body, etc)
Create a file attachment
Send the message
Clean up
Usage:
Load the project from Visual Studio 2005, and build normally.
Run the application normally. The sample application has no UI and requires
no interaction. After running the application, check your Outbox
or Sent Items (depending on your network / partnership access) and you
should see your message(s).
Relevant APIs/Associated Help Topics:
CEMAPI
MapiLogonEx
SRowSet
IMapiSession::GetMsgStoresTable
IMapiSession::OpenMsgStore
IMapiTable::QueryRows
IMsgStore::OpenEntry
IMsgStore::GetProps
IMapiFolder::CreateMessage
IMessage::SubmitMessage
MAPIFreeBuffer
FreeProws
Assumptions: none.
Requirements:
Visual Studio 2005,
Windows Mobile 5.0 Pocket PC SDK or
Windows Mobile 5.0 Smartphone SDK
ActiveSync 4.0.
